Exploring the Stars: Essential Equipment for Astro-Navigation Systems
Embarking on a journey through the vastness of space requires precise navigation tools to guide you accurately among the stars. Astro-navigation systems are essential for determining your position, course, and trajectory in the cosmos. To enable smooth and successful space exploration, equipping yourself with the right tools is crucial. Here are some must-have equipment for astro-navigation systems:
Celestial Sphere
The celestial sphere is a fundamental tool for understanding the apparent motion of celestial bodies in the sky. It provides a reference point for mapping out stars, planets, and other astronomical objects.

Sextant
A sextant is a precise navigational instrument used to measure the angle between two objects, typically a celestial body and the horizon. It is invaluable for determining one's position accurately in space.

Star Charts
Star charts are maps of the night sky that help astronomers and space explorers identify and locate celestial objects. They are essential for plotting courses and identifying reference points in space.

Telescope
A telescope is a powerful tool for observing distant objects in space. It allows astronomers to study celestial bodies, planetary movements, and other phenomena essential for navigation and exploration.

Chronometer
A chronometer is a precise timekeeping device crucial for calculating longitude and determining accurate positions in space. It helps space travelers maintain accurate time references during their journey.
